The Creative Podcast is dedicated to growing the creativity that is already inside of you. We will have interviews with creative people from all walks of life to help you gain perspective on how creativity works for them!
This episode I discuss what it means to dive in to a certain style not just a technique. It means learning what came before and what can be done to grow the technique into a part of your language.

On this episode we discuss keeping it simple... Meaning don't try to do to much to fast. Understand what your good at and build around that. Grow a solid foundation to create upon and you will be more successful.
I see and hear people trying to throw to much into a single project. I feel that doing one thing great is better than doing a few things just alright.

On this episode of The Creative Podcast we discuss how focusing on the tools that help make art and not the art itself can ruin your progress as a creative.
We all long for new and better gear and let that stop us from taking chances with what we already have. This episode is to encourage you to push your gear to the limit and create with what you have.
